Output 86a5c24e3ddbae7707575bec6dea6c8a237bbd3e8b576aa7a7950cce61587c90:0

value
4784184
script pubkey
OP_0 OP_PUSHBYTES_20 cfc6339a5f1df4d8dc057a24104339a0c9b438e0
address
bc1qelrr8xjlrh6d3hq90gjpqsee5rymgw8qdxygac
transaction
86a5c24e3ddbae7707575bec6dea6c8a237bbd3e8b576aa7a7950cce61587c90
confirmations
153047
spent
true